Getting around
🚶 Walking — The Nob Hill / Alphabet District is one of Portland's most walkable neighborhoods. NW 23rd and NW 21st avenues are lined with restaurants, boutiques, cafes, and bars — all within a few minutes' walk. 🚌 Bus — TriMet Route 15 (Belmont/NW 23rd) runs along NW 23rd Avenue with frequent service every 15 minutes to downtown (~10 min). 🚲 Biking — BIKETOWN bike-share stations nearby. Portland's extensive bike lane network makes cycling easy and safe throughout the city. 🚗 Driving — Street parking is available (read signs for time limits and meters). Rideshare (Uber/Lyft) typically arrives in under 5 minutes. ✈️ Airport — PDX is about 19 minutes by car or reachable via MAX Blue/Red Line from nearby Providence Park station.
